Role Summary

 

Rivian Finance seeks an Operational Audit Senior to collaborate with colleagues and stakeholders in the delivery of impactful operational and integrated audits. The ideal candidate will have proven experience navigating unfamiliar processes, identifying risks, and executing the audit plan. As an Operational Audit Senior, you will have the opportunity to tap into your curiosity and collaborate with some of the most innovative and diverse people.

Responsibilities

 

Conducting process walkthroughs and mapping complex process flows and risks including their impact on downstream processes, reporting, and metrics;

Executing operational and integrated audits including reviews of new and enhanced business processes, process changes, and system implementations;

Identifying risks, constructing a risk assessment, leveraging data analysis, and develop an audit programs;

Execute against an audit program

Interpreting testing and walkthrough results to identify unmitigated risks and areas of process improvements;

Monitoring closure of management's action plans;

Establishing and maintaining effective relationships with business partners and key stakeholders;

Qualifications

 

4+ years of progressive audit experience in either Big 4 public accounting, and/or in industry;

Bachelor's or Master's degree in a relevant discipline (e.g. Business, Accounting, Information Technology, Law);

CPA or CIA certification (or equivalent) required or in active pursuit;

Ability to effectively communicate, both written and verbal, in a clear and concise manner;

Demonstrated ability to evaluate business processes;

Ability to look ahead, anticipate questions, independently assess risk, and think critically and creatively;

Highly organized, able to work flexibly across boundaries and navigate in dynamic environments;

Travel up to 20% of the time.
